The Facts:
The HSS 4000 features 512 MB RAM and a 1.0 GHz Pentium 4 processor while the HSS 6000 features 1 GB of RAM and a 2.8 GHz Pentium 4 processor.

The HSS 4000 offers four flex ports while the HSS 6000 offers six. Flex ports can be used for LAN or WAN connections configurable as needed. Additional hardware assets include internal hard drives and an optional hardware-based VPN accelerator (flexible software-based VPNs are standard). Both products provide the desirable hardware failover (CARP) feature.
The HSS 4000 supports up to 1,000 LAN users while the HSS 6000 allows for an unlimited number of LAN users. Both products support CIDR-based Class A, B, and C networks.
Easy to install, the HSS 4000 and HSS 6000 are also simple to configure and manageable directly from the user-friendly and secure web GUI (HTTPS), console port and SSH secure connection. The content-filtering, Spam-filtering, and antivirus options can also be managed directly from the interface itself – where they should be. The content-filtering feature is web-based while the Spam-filtering and Antivirus reside on the unit’s hard drive.
Both products support QoS with bandwidth management and Voice over IP (VOIP).
